Company: Forrards
Location: EU only
Format: remote EU
Rate: $5.5-6k/month (35-40$/hour)
We are looking for a motivated Senior Data Engineer (ADB + Python) who is willing to dive into the new project with a modern stack. If you’re driven by a curiosity to learn and a desire to produce meaningful results, please apply!
*About the Client*
Our client is one of the Big Four accounting firms and the world’s largest professional services network. Headquartered in London, they operate in 150+ countries with 460,000+ professionals delivering excellence in audit, tax, consulting, and advisory.
The team you will join designs, develops, and deploys innovative enterprise technology and AI-driven tools to support the delivery of tax services. It is a dynamic group combining expertise in tax, software engineering, change management, and project management, working on initiatives from tool design and deployment to training development and engagement management.
*Project Tech Stack*
Azure Cloud, Microservices Architecture, .NET 8, ASP.NET. Core services, Python, MongoDB, Azure SQL, Angular 18, Kendo, GitHub Enterprise with Copilot, LangGraph, LangChain, RAG Pipelines, Multi-modal LLMs
*What You’ll Do*
• Define and enforce best practices and coding standards across the project
• Conduct thorough code reviews to ensure adherence to established guidelines and maintain high code quality
• Work both independently and in close collaboration with others in the team
• Communicate clear instructions to team members and help manage the flow of day-to-day operations
• Communicate with the client regularly
• Design, develop, and maintain robust and scalable Spark applications
• Write clean, maintainable, and efficient code following best practices and coding standards
• Optimize code for performance and scalability, ensuring efficient data handling
• Work closely with cross-functional teams to deliver high-quality software solutions
• Identify and resolve technical issues, ensuring the reliability and performance of applications
• Create and maintain comprehensive documentation for code, processes, and workflows
*What You Bring*
• 5+ years of hands-on experience in software development
• Extensive experience working with Apache Spark, including platforms such as Databricks and/or Azure Synapse/Fabric
• Proficient in Python, with strong skills in data manipulation using Pandas/Polars and similar
• Solid understanding of columnar data storage formats, particularly Parquet, with practical experience using Delta Tables
• Proven expertise in data processing, analysis, and transformation workflows
• Strong analytical and problem-solving abilities with a detail-oriented mindset
• Practical and pragmatic approach to balancing standardized processes with flexibility to meet project goals effectively
• Excellent organizational skills with the ability to self-manage, prioritize tasks, structure workload, and meet tight deadlines
• Solid understanding of microservices architecture and its implementation in scalable systems
*Nice to have*
• Experience working with Azure Cloud services (or other major cloud platforms), including Service Bus, Data Lake, Blob Storage, Redis, etc.
• Familiarity with FastAPI
• Expertise in containerization and orchestration tools such as Docker and Kubernetes
*English level*
Intermediate+
.
Recruiter Показать контакты
Будьте осторожны: если работодатель просит войти в их систему, используя iCloud/Google, прислать код/пароль, запустить код/ПО, не делайте этого - это мошенники. Обязательно жмите "Пожаловаться" или пишите в поддержку. Подробнее в гайде →
Текст вакансии взят без изменений
Источник - Telegram канал. Название доступно после авторизации